God of Cricket (Hindi: गॉड ऑफ क्रिकेट) is a 2021 Bollywood biopic sports film. The film was released on 24 April 2021. Directed by Sudesh Kanojia and co-produced by Vinay Bhardwaj and Pranav Jain, the film features Sangram Singh as a cricketer in lead among others.[2][3][4]

It revolves around the fictional events with a chronicle documentary of Sachin Tendulkar, a former Indian cricketer often recognized for his highest scored runs in international cricket.[5]

Plot[edit]

The epic sports film revolves around a teenager who works as a hockey coach, despite his parents wanted him to choose cricket over hockey. He subsequently writes a letter to Sachin Tendulkar.[4]

Production[edit]

In association with Chand Jannat Films along with Yellowstone Studios, it is produced under the banner of Shining Sun Studios. The development of film production is intended to acclaim Tendulkar's contribution to the first-class cricket.[2]
